Do these thing just fall apart??
 
Ok I have not been on in a while, But I am very pissed at my 99 jimmy. I bought it and i love it, but it has only 75k on it and i bought it at 70k, I changed the oil evry 3k. It was fine when i bought it but here is what is going wrong now, first the engine tick/knocks when it is cold and it is a very loud tick,and while it is ticking the engine runs very ruff and will sometimes throw a code which i am assuming is a misfire. Also the voltage surges beetween 13 and 14.5 constantly making my lights dim. and know the key wont come out of the ignition unless you beat on the steering colum, I twill turn back but now to the off position. I have only had it for three months it is falling apart. I had big plans for it but if it is going to be like this forever i am getting rid of it. Can any one help me fix these problems?

Jigg 12-11-2006 02:13 PM

RE: Do these thing just fall apart??
 
Change your oil to castrol cold start. It'll take care of the lifters ticking when it's cold out. I ran it for one oil change and my lifters haven't ticked in another 20k miles.

Get the code checked. It might not be a misfire, could be something very simple.

When does the voltmeter surge?

For taking the key out, try turning the steering wheel a bit to take the pressure off of the lock.

These are all pretty simple problems... they're all part of owning a vehicle.

Chevy Lover 12-12-2006 01:32 AM

RE: Do these thing just fall apart??
 
Can you get it scanned and let us know what the code is?
If the spark is weak in a cylinder you could experience a missfire and a ticking or knocking noise.

I would recommend checking the connections at the battery and the alternater and any other grounds that you can see.

As for the key problem...do you have a floor or cloumn shift?
this could be caused by the brake transmission shift interlock out of adjustment or the shift linkage out of adjustment.
